Maker(s):Squire, Maude Hunt
Culture:American (1873 - 1955)
Title:Two Women
Date Made:1903
Type:Print
Materials:etching printed in black with hand coloring on medium weight, slightly textured, beige paper
Measurements:sheet: 12 5/8 in x 9 1/8 in; 32.1 cm x 23.2 cm; Image: 5 5/8 in x 3 3/4 in; 14.3 cm x 9.5 cm
Narrative Inscription:  signature, location and date in pencil in bottom margin: M. Squire / Munchen / 1903
Accession Number:  SC 2014.32.692
Credit Line:The Gladys Engel Lang and Kurt Lang Collection
Museum Collection:  Smith College Museum of Art
2014_32_692.jpg

Description:
Middle aged woman in blue hat with plumage, and light blue suit jacket with heavy braiding, sitting at cafe table, turned towards a second woman in similar blue suit and glasses. Women, female, conversation.
